Abstract

According to the results of observations of Federal agency Roshydromet, the specific signs of recent decades are climate changes caused by global warming. Their features are an increase in the average annual temperature, frequency and intensity of dangerous hydrometeorological phenomena, an increase in the amount of precipitation, spatial and seasonal heterogeneity. The territories of Russia are in the area of observed and predicted climate changes, and their consequences have an increasing impact on the socio-economic development of the country, the living conditions and health of people, as well as on the state of economic sectors and objects of economic activity. The article examines measures to adapt the sphere of management of construction and demolition waste (CDW) to the negative consequences of climate change.
